Judd Michael Vance, 57, passed away July 2, 2026, surrounded by loved ones in Wichita, Kansas. He was born May 8, 1969, in Oswego, Kansas, to Billy Leon and Dorthea Sue (Eastland) Vance. He married Lisa Lynn Winter July 21, 2001, in Wichita.
He grew up in Parsons, Kansas, and graduated from Parsons High School in 1987. He attended Kansas State University in Manhattan, Kansas, where he graduated with a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ering in 1993. He then moved to Wichita, where he worked for Bosch Home Comfort for 29 years, advancing from Principal Engineer to Staff Engineer and specializing in heat pumps.
Judd tremendously enjoyed playing board games and made significant contributions to the Board Game Geek community, eagerly sharing his knowledge and passion for gaming through recording videos and developing Vassal modules. He also loved traveling with his wife and daughters, ultimately visiting 47 U.S. states and over 40 National Parks. He had a passion for learning and for sharing his knowledge with others, and he continually read about and expanded his knowledge of history, sports, music, science fiction, and comics.
For years, he developed and refined his cooking skills by lovingly preparing meals for his family. He also volunteered his time coaching his daughters’ youth softball teams and serving his church’s AWANA program. Other activities he enjoyed included bike riding, going on walks with his wife, and spending time with his dogs over the years. Judd was a passionate, intelligent, and thoughtful man who loved the Lord and loved others well. Above all, he was a beloved servant of Christ.
He is survived by his loving wife, Lisa Vance, his daughters, Sara and Erin Vance, his father, Billy Leon Vance, Billy’s wife, Rosie Vance, his sister, Jan Vance, and his brother-in law, Brad Winter. He was preceded in death by his mother, Dorthea Sue Vance, and his grandparents, Henry and Alice Dorthea Eastland and Billy Chester and Treva Vance.
